Question 63382: You are confronted with the following formula:
A * [(B + C)(D - E) - F(G*H) ] / J = 10
Knowing that each variable is a unique, single-digit, nonzero number, and that C - B = 1, and H - G = 3, what is the number ABCDEFGHJ, where each letter is a digit? For example, if A = 4, B = 2, and C = 7, ABC would equal 427.
Answer by 303795(602)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Two possible answers (brute force using a spreadsheet)
A=2, B=6, C=7, D=8, E=3, F=5, G=1, H=4, J=9
OR
A=2, B=6, C=7, D=9, E=5, F=3, G=1, H=4, J=8
